Duties and Responsibilities:


  • Execute FGI Customer Service Standard by resolving service desk problems and improving service methods to increase the service desk's productivity
  • Plan work schedules and assign duties to maintain adequate staffing levels and ensure that activities are performed safely and effectively.
  • Maintaining a strong working knowledge of industry regulations, restrictions, and laws, ensuring the company's adherence to these regulations, and remaining current on the industry's standards and new innovations, materials, tools, and processes.
  • Delegating and directing service tasks, monitoring the progress of current projects, evaluating its efficiency, and managing service team members to ensure the team's goals are met
  • Ensure special order product returns and warranty claims are processed in a timely manner
  • Conducting periodic spot checks of all jobs throughout the day to ensure timely repairs, quality workmanship, safety, and cleanliness.
  • Assisting with or performing administrative tasks, such as reviewing work orders, managing, and updating invoices, processing new orders, and tracking inventory.


Qualifications & Experience:


  • Effective verbal and written communication skills
  • Demonstrated good leadership, problem solving and team building skills
  • 3-5 years of related experience in high volume customer service preferably in automotive, or heavy-duty parts service
  • Proven mechanical abilities and strong working knowledge of mechanical application or repair techniques. (Heavy Duty mechanic or Journeyman ticket an asset)
  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Post secondary diploma or degree in a mechanical field and/or business administration is preferred
